# Listar Transacciones Devuelve todas las transacciones creadas en el entorno. Endpoint: GET /transaction/ Version: 1.0 Security: AppKeys ## Response 200 fields (application/json): - `count` (number) Cantidad de elementos - `items_per_page` (number) Cantidad de elementos por página - `next` (string,null) URL a próxima página - `previous` (string,null) URL a página anterior - `results` (array) - `results.id` (string) Identificador único - `results.token` (string) Token de transacción. Se utiliza para representar la transacción de cara al usuario - `results.status` (string) Estado de la transacción (N - Pendiente, C - Cancelada, D - Completada, E - Expirada) Enum: "N", "C", "D", "E" - `results.items_price` (number) Precio total de todos los productos - `results.total_price` (number) Precio a pagar - `results.order_id` (string) Identificador externo - `results.currency` (string, required) Moneda en formato ISO - `results.note` (string) Nota - `results.extra` (object) Valores extra en formato JSON - `results.return_url` (string) URL de retorno. Se envía al cliente a esta url después de realizar el pago correctamente - `results.cancel_url` (string) URL de cancelación. Se envía al cliente a esta url si cancela el pago - `results.notify_url` (string) URL de notificación. Se envían a esta url las notificaciones de cambio de estado - `results.gateway_selected` (boolean) Si cuando el cliente abra la pantalla de pago la primera opción debe estar seleccionada - `results.language` (string) Idioma de la pantalla de pago Enum: "au", "es", "en", "fr" - `results.expired_date` (string) Fecha de expiración (por defecto, es una semana después de la creación) - `results.products` (array, required) Lista de elementos de producto - `results.products.amount` (number, required) Cantidad del producto - `results.products.product_id` (string) Identificador del producto existente en el API (requerido si no se envía el parámetro product) - `results.products.product` (object) Representa el modelo de datos para crear un producto. - `results.products.product.product_id` (string) Identificador externo - `results.products.product.name` (string, required) Nombre - `results.products.product.price` (number, required) Precio - `results.products.product.description` (string) Descripción - `results.tax_value` (number) Cantidad a pagar relacionada con el impuesto - `results.tax_name` (string) Nombre del impuesto incluido en la transacción - `results.tax` (string) Identificador de impuesto existente en el API - `results.shipping_value` (number) Cantidad a pagar relacionada con el envío - `results.shipping_name` (string) Nombre del envío incluido en la transacción - `results.shipping` (string) Identificador de envío existente en el API - `results.coupon_value` (number) Cantidad a descontar relacionada con el cupón - `results.coupon_name` (string) Nombre del cupón incluido en la transacción - `results.coupon` (string) Identificador de cupón existente en el API - `results.authorize` (boolean) Si se hace una retención o no (por defecto: false) - `results.source` (array,null) Origen de los fondos - `results.source.amount` (number, required) Cantidad - `results.source.wallet_id` (string) Identificador de Cuenta de Pago - `results.source.authorization_id` (string) Identificador de Autorización - `results.destination` (array,null) Destino de los fondos